Identification of leaf rust genes in wheat varieties through sts markers
Leaf rust caused by Puccinia triticinia is the most destructive disease which reduces wheat production. Thirty-eight wheat varieties were screened for four leaf rust resistance genes viz. Lr10, Lr26, Lr34 and Lr47 through STS markers. Among them Lr10 gene showed its presence in 16 genotypes, Lr26 in 8, both Lr34 and Lr47 in 10 each. Variety Anza+2ns showed promising results by the presence of three Lr genes (Lr10, Lr26 and Lr47) surely recommended for crop improvement and/or direct utility at farmers field. Chakwal-97, Indus-79, Marwat-Y-01, Mumal-2002, Khyber-83, Pasban-90, Pari-73, Lr-268, and Satluge-86 showed 2 genes presence while 23 with single gene and 5 without any response. A diagnostic band of size 310, 258, 1000 and 380-450 bps was amplified showing presence of Lr10, Lr34, Lr26 and Lr47. Marker STS are suggested for large scale germplasm screening during marker assisted breeding. Bangladesh J. Bot. 52(3): 709-714, 2023 (September)

Bangladesh Journal of Botany is the official organ of the Bangladesh Botanical Society established in 1972. Since 1972 Bangladesh Journal of Botany is being published regularly. Two issues of the Journal are published, one in June and another in December.
Scientific papers (Full paper and short communication) on any field of Plant Sciences from anywhere in the World are considered for publication in Bangladesh Journal of Botany.
